Automation QA Engineer
  • Job Location:    ITPB Whitefield, Bengaluru / Commerzone IT Park, Yerwada-Pune


  • Required Experience: 03 - 05 Years.


We’re looking for a Senior QA Automation Engineer to strengthen our quality engineering efforts across UI and API testing. The ideal candidate will be hands-on with Selenium/Playwright, experienced with Postman or REST Assured, and driven to contribute to framework enhancements, suggest improvements, and champion quality within an Agile setup.


Responsibilities:


  • Design, enhance, and maintain scalable automation frameworks for UI and API testing using Selenium/Playwright.


  • Ability to develop and maintain automation test scripts for Selenium/Playwright in Java programming language.


  • Develop and execute automated regression, smoke, and functional test suites integrated with CI/CD pipelines.


  • Proactively identify gaps, suggest process and framework improvements, and drive adoption of best practices.


  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define test strategies, improve coverage, and ensure high-quality releases.


  • Manage test cases, execution results, and reporting in TestRail.


  • Participate actively in Agile ceremonies, contributing to sprint planning, estimations, and retrospectives.


  • Mentor junior QA engineers and help evolve automation standards across teams.


  • Foster a culture of innovation, ownership, and continuous learning within the QA organization.


Skills & Qualifications:


  • 3–5 years of experience in QA automation and Java Programming


  • Proven hands-on experience with Selenium/Playwright for UI automation.


  • Solid experience in API testing using Postman or REST Assured


  • Experience integrating automation with CI/CD tools (Jenkins, GitHub Actions, or GitLab CI).


  • Familiarity with Agile/Scrum methodology and TestRail (or similar test management tools).


  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.


  • Proactive and detail-oriented with a continuous improvement mindset.


Education:  Bachelor’s degree or equivalent required
